Pulse For Good Named to Inaugural PurposeBuilt100, America's 100 Fastest-Growing Mission-Driven
S For Story/10697185
The anonymous-feedback company for social services is one of 100 winners chosen from thousands screened; ranked reveal at SuperCrowd26, August 25–27, 2026.
LOGAN, Utah - s4story -- Pulse For Good, which helps organizations serving vulnerable populations safely collect honest, anonymous feedback, has been named to the inaugural PurposeBuilt100, a national recognition of the 100 fastest-growing mission-driven businesses in America.
The PurposeBuilt100 program, from the public benefit corporation The Super Crowd, Inc., honors mission-driven businesses on their impact and ranks them by growth — and it cannot be bought into. Its 100 honorees rose from thousands of companies reviewed across the country, and their ranking will be unveiled at SuperCrowd26 featuring PurposeBuilt100, a three-day nationally televised event on August 25–27, 2026. The alphabetical list is posted at PurposeBuilt100.com.
"Blake Kohler built Pulse For Good so that the people served by shelters and clinics can safely say what they really think — and be heard," said Devin Thorpe, founder of PurposeBuilt100 and CEO of The Super Crowd, Inc. "Thousands of companies were considered; only 100 made the list. Pulse For Good earned its place by turning honest feedback into better, more dignified services."

Led by co-founder and CEO Blake Kohler, Pulse For Good provides feedback kiosks and software used by shelters, behavioral-health providers, and community health centers to gather input while protecting people's dignity.
"We founded Pulse For Good to remove fear and power dynamics from feedback, so organizations serving vulnerable people can hear the honest truth and act on it," said Blake Kohler, co-founder and CEO of Pulse For Good. "This recognition belongs to our team and the shelters, clinics, and community organizations that put dignity first. Listening well is how services get better."
About Pulse For Good
Pulse For Good helps organizations serving vulnerable populations safely collect honest, anonymous feedback to improve services and protect the dignity of the people they serve. Learn more at https://www.pulseforgood.com.
